Mont-Grand-Fonds is a ski area in La Malbaie; Charlevoix-Est, Quebec, Canada. It is classified as a small locality. Mont-Grand-Fonds is located at 47.7711°N, 70.1025°W.
Mont-Grand-Fonds rises with quiet authority above the St. Lawrence, its slopes anchored firmly near the Montagne de la Rivière Noire. It lies 13.7 km north-north-east of La Malbaie, QC (from La Malbaie, QC: bearing 15°T), and is situated 12.6 km north-east of Clermont.
